Engineering Team, which is subscribed to cloud-init. https://bugs.launchpad.net/bugs/1901958 Title: FreeBSD fix fs related bugs Status in cloud-init: Fix Released Bug description: 1) FreeBSD not support vfat use msdosfs Original report https://bugs.freebsd.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=250496 "Feel free to submit upstream if you have signed the CLA. I do not want to sign it." 2) if fs have trim: (-t) or MAC multilabel: (-l) flag, resize FS fail. https://www.freebsd.org/cgi/man.cgi?query=tunefs&sektion=8 2020-10-28 17:15:07,015 - handlers.py[DEBUG]: finish: init-network/config-resizefs: FAIL: running config-resizefs with frequency always ... File "/usr/local/lib/python3.7/site-packages/cloudinit/config/cc_resizefs.py", line 114, in _can_skip_resize_ufs optlist, _args = getopt.getopt(newfs_cmd[1:], opt_value) File "/usr/local/lib/python3.7/getopt.py", line 95, in getopt opts, args = do_shorts(opts, args[0][1:], shortopts, args[1:]) File "/usr/local/lib/python3.7/getopt.py", line 195, in do_shorts if short_has_arg(opt, shortopts): File "/usr/local/lib/python3.7/getopt.py", line 211, in short_has_arg raise GetoptError(_('option -%s not recognized') % opt, opt) getopt.GetoptError: option -t not recognized To manage notifications about this bug go to: https://bugs.launchpad.net/cloud-init/+bug/1901958/+subscriptions -- Mailing list: https://launchpad.net/~yahoo-eng-team Post to : yahoo-eng-team@lists.launchpad.net Unsubscribe : https://launchpad.net/~yahoo-eng-team More help : https://help.launchpad.net/ListHelp
